Work Around #1:

<TrinityMaxDeaths questId="1" max="25" />
Add the blue line that's above into the profile\xml file that your issue is occurring on.

An example is provided below:
Code:
<Profile>
  <Name>Just an Example</Name>
  <KillMonsters>Obviously</KillMonsters>
  <PickupLoot>Obviously</PickupLoot>
  <GameParams quest="1" step="-1" act="OpenWorld" resumeFromSave="False" isPrivate="True" numGames="-1" />

  <Order>
	<ToggleTargeting questId="1" stepId="1" combat="True" looting="True" lootRadius="150" killRadius="80" />
[COLOR="#000080"]          <TrinityMaxDeaths questId="1" max="50" />[/COLOR]

                .........more example code...... more code....
          .........more code...... more code....
                .........more example code...... more code....

  </Order>
</Profile>

I seen people recommending looking for and removing the <TrinityMaxDeaths questId="1" max="1" /> from any profiles they used... but most people could not find the entry at all. So with a little reverse psychology... I figured why not ADD the line, increase the number, and see if it overrides the DemonBuddy feature... and it did.

Issue here is that if maxdeath is not set in the profile the max death is actually handled by Questhelper and the file botevents.cs and not by trinity nor DB. In this file you have the following piece of code.


private static void GameEvents_OnPlayerDied(object sender, EventArgs e)
{
Death.DeathCount++;
Death.LastDeathTime = DateTime.UtcNow;

Logger.Log("Player died! Position={0} QuestId={1} StepId={2} WorldId={3}",
ZetaDia.Me.Position, ZetaDia.CurrentQuest.QuestSNO, ZetaDia.CurrentQuest.StepId, ZetaDia.CurrentWorldId);

Death.MaxDeathsAllowed = 10;


if (Death.MaxDeathsAllowed <= 0)
return;

if (Death.DeathCount < Death.MaxDeathsAllowed)
return;

Logger.Log("You have died too many times. Now restarting the game.");
ProfileManager.Load(ProfileManager.CurrentProfile.Path);
ZetaDia.Service.Party.LeaveGame(true);

// This is bad, we shouldn't do this :(
Thread.Sleep(12000);
}

Adding the line with bold and red, should give you 10 deaths before a new game is created incase it havent been added in the profile.
